1. Harvard Law School

Location: Cambridge, Massachusetts, USA
Notable Programs: Juris Doctor (JD), Master of Laws (LL.M), Doctor of Juridical Science (SJD)
Key Highlights:
Harvard Law School is renowned for its rigorous academic programs and distinguished faculty. As one of the oldest and most prestigious law schools in the world, it offers a comprehensive curriculum that covers various legal fields. The school’s extensive alumni network includes influential legal professionals, policymakers, and judges.

2. Yale Law School

Location: New Haven, Connecticut, USA
Notable Programs: Juris Doctor (JD), Master of Laws (LL.M), PhD in Law
Key Highlights:
Yale Law School is celebrated for its emphasis on interdisciplinary study and its innovative approach to legal education. The school’s small class sizes and faculty mentorship contribute to a personalized educational experience. Yale Law graduates often hold influential positions in law, government, and academia.

3. Stanford Law School

Location: Stanford, California, USA
Notable Programs: Juris Doctor (JD), Master of Laws (LL.M), Joint Degree Programs
Key Highlights:
Stanford Law School combines a strong emphasis on legal theory with practical application. The school’s location in Silicon Valley provides unique opportunities for students interested in technology law and entrepreneurship. Stanford’s innovative curriculum and its focus on global legal issues are among its many strengths.

4. University of Oxford

Location: Oxford, England, UK
Notable Programs: Bachelor of Civil Law (BCL), Master of Laws (LL.M), Doctor of Philosophy (DPhil)
Key Highlights:
Oxford University offers a prestigious legal education with a focus on critical thinking and research. The Bachelor of Civil Law (BCL) is a particularly notable program, attracting students from around the world. Oxford’s rich academic tradition and global perspective enhance its reputation in legal studies.

8. University of Chicago Law School

Location: Chicago, Illinois, USA
Notable Programs: Juris Doctor (JD), Master of Laws (LL.M), Executive LLM
Key Highlights:
The University of Chicago Law School is known for its rigorous academic environment and commitment to theoretical and empirical legal research. Its unique curriculum and strong focus on law and economics distinguish it from other law schools. Chicago Law’s vibrant intellectual community is a major attraction for students.

FAQs

1. What factors should I consider when choosing a law school?
When choosing a law school, consider factors such as the institution’s reputation, faculty expertise, program specializations, internship opportunities, and location.

2. How important is the location of a law school?
Location can impact internship opportunities, networking, and exposure to specific legal markets. For example, schools in major cities often provide more opportunities for practical experience.

3. What are the benefits of attending a top law school?
Attending a top law school can offer benefits such as prestigious faculty, strong alumni networks, high job placement rates, and access to cutting-edge resources and research facilities.

4. Are there any scholarships available for law students?
Many law schools offer scholarships based on merit or financial need. It’s important to research and apply for scholarships early to help manage the cost of legal education.

5. How can I improve my chances of getting into a top law school?
Focus on achieving strong academic performance, gaining relevant experience through internships or work, obtaining strong letters of recommendation, and preparing thoroughly for the LSAT or equivalent entrance exams.
